2. Types of French Driving Licenses
In France, driving licenses are categorized based upon the lorry type. The classifications define what lorries a holder is lawfully allowed to run.
Classification
Vehicle Type
Minimum Age
Particular Notes
A
Bikes
24
A1 for light motorbikes (as much as 125cc) available from age 16
B
Automobiles
18
Most typical classification for individual vehicles
C
Heavy items automobiles
21
Needed for automobiles exceeding 3.5 loads
D
Buses
24
Required for buses with over 9 seats
BE
Trailer mix
18
For towing trailers over 750 kg

3. Eligibility Criteria
To request a French driving license, prospects must fulfill specific eligibility requirements, which consist of:
- Age Requirement: Applicants should be at least 18 years old for a complete automobile license (B category).
- Residency: Proof of residency in France is required.
- Medical Fitness: A medical checkup may be needed to verify physical fitness to drive.
- Theoretical Knowledge: Candidates must pass a theory test covering the guidelines of the road.
4. The Application Process
The procedure of obtaining a French driving license involves several actions, culminating in both theoretical and useful examinations.
4.1 Necessary Documents
Before using, candidates ought to prepare the following documents:
Document
Description
Identity evidence
National ID or passport
Proof of residency
Utility bills, lease, or official files
Medical physical fitness certificate
Provided by a recognized physician
Certificate of conclusion
From a licensed driving school
Recent passport-sized pictures
Usually two pictures
4.2 Steps to Apply
- Enroll in a Driving School: Candidates must select a qualified driving school, which will prepare them for both the theory and useful tests.
- Total the Theory Exam: Upon conclusion of the theory class, candidates will take the composed examination.
- Practice Driving: Accumulate a minimum variety of practice hours with an instructor.
- Pass the Practical Driving Exam: Schedule and take the driving test to show driving proficiency.
- Get License: Following successful conclusion of both tests, candidates will be released their driving license.
5. Expenses Involved
The process of obtaining a French driving license sustains numerous expenses. The approximate expenses involved are as follows:
Item
Approximated Cost (in Euros)
Driving School Fees
1,000 - 1,800
Theory Exam Fee
30 - 50
Practical Exam Fee
120 - 250
Medical Checkup Fee
30 - 100
Overall Estimated Cost
1,200 - 2,200
Keep in mind:
Prices may vary based on place and driving school. It's suggested for prospects to research study and compare costs.
6. Rules and Regulations
Holders of a French driving license must follow the following rules and policies:
- Legal Driving Age: As stated in license categories.
- No Tolerance for Alcohol: The legal blood alcohol limitation is 0.05% however is lower for beginner drivers.
- Traffic Laws: Compliance with speed limits, seatbelt use, and road signs is necessary.
- Points System: Offenses can lead to point reductions from the license. Building up 12 points may lead to license suspension.
7. Renewal and Validity
- Preliminary Validity: The initial driving license stands for 15 years.
- Renewal Process: Drivers must renew their license proactively; renewal needs submitting application types, providing recognition, and perhaps undergoing a medical evaluation.
- Change of Details: Any changes in personal information (e.g., address, name) must be reported and upgraded on the driving license.
8. Typical FAQs
1. Can I drive in France with a foreign driving license?
Yes, foreign driving licenses are generally legitimate for use in France, however long-lasting residents will require to exchange them for a French license after a specific duration.
2. What happens if I lose my French driving license?
Report the loss to a regional police headquarters and obtain a replacement through the local prefecture.
3. Is it needed to take driving lessons?
It is highly suggested to take driving lessons from a licensed school to ensure a great grasp of driving guidelines and roadway security.
4. How do I inspect my points stabilize?
You can inspect your points balance online through the French federal government's main motorist service websites.
